The 5 Myths Keeping You Stuck Before Your Remodel Even Begins
Myth 1: I Need Everything Figured Out Before I Start
You don’t need answers — you need direction.
Planning is where clarity happens.
Design is a process of:
Choosing
Adjusting
Reworking
Changing your mind
That’s normal. That’s expected.
✨ You are allowed to evolve your ideas before demo.
Myth 2: I Should Start by Calling a Contractor
This one causes so much confusion.
Without a plan:
Estimates are guesses
Budgets are hypothetical
Contractors can’t guide design decisions
🛑 Calling a contractor without clarity creates overwhelm — not solutions.
✅ Planning protects you before money is spent.
Myth 3: Pinterest Will Help Me Figure It All Out
Pinterest is inspiration — not strategy.
Without:
Priorities
Budget awareness
Functional needs
Pinterest becomes an endless scroll of everything is possible… and nothing feels doable.
📌 Use Pinterest after you have structure — not before.
Myth 4: Once I Start, I’m Locked In
This is one of the most damaging beliefs.
Designing before demo is your biggest advantage.
You are in exploratory mode:
You can test ideas
You can change your mind
You can refine without pressure
✔️ Taking one step forward does not lock you in.

Myth 5: If I Don’t Feel Confident, I’m Not Ready
Confidence does not come first.
Confidence comes from:
Understanding your priorities
Seeing how decisions affect your budget
Creating a roadmap step by step
✨ You gain confidence as you move through the process — not before it.
What Actually Helps You Start a Remodel
Starting your renovation means:
Getting clear on your priorities
Understanding budget impact
Creating a roadmap — not a final answer
Making decisions in the right order
This is how overwhelm drops away.
Not by knowing everything.
But by knowing what matters now.
